✦Decanter of Endless Water
This stoppered flask sloshes when shaken, as if it contains water. The decanter weighs 2 pounds.
You can take a Magic action to remove the stopper and issue one of three command words, whereupon an amount of fresh water or salt water (your choice) pours out of the flask. The water stops pouring out at the start of your next turn. Choose from the following command words:
- Splash: The decanter produces 1 gallon of water. - Fountain: The decanter produces 5 gallons of water. - Geyser: The decanter produces 30 gallons of water that gushes forth in a Line [Area of Effect] 30 feet long and 1 foot wide. If you're holding the decanter, you can aim the geyser in one direction (no action required). One creature of your choice in the Line [Area of Effect] must succeed on a DC 13 Strength saving throw or take 1d4 Bludgeoning damage and have the Prone condition. Instead of a creature, you can target one object in the Line [Area of Effect] that isn't being worn or carried and that weighs no more than 200 pounds. The object is knocked over by the geyser.
